Beautiful Detached House With Private Gardens, Glasgow

Glasgow. Sleeps up to 6

Enjoy a holiday at this tranquil and family-friendly home, just five miles from Glasgow City Centre.

The Space:
Downstairs there is a beautifully decorated, open-plan living and dining room with 55-inch 4k television and Sky Q subscription. There is also a large kitchen and utility room, complete with; oven, fridge, freezer, dishwasher and washing machine - in addition to other standard equipment e.g. toaster, kettle, microwave etc.

Upstairs there is a large master bedroom complete with super-king bed, en-suite bathroom & shower, and built-in wardrobe. In the second bedroom there is a double bed, with built-in wardrobe.

Additionally there is a further large room upstairs with a seating area, bookcase and piano. Ironing facilities are also available in this room. This room can also be set up with a double bed, at your request.

On this floor you’ll also find the main bathroom with a large spa bath and shower, in addition to sink and toilet facilities.

Outside, there are private front and rear gardens, with luxury outdoor furniture to help you relax.

Guest Access:
Guest has exclusive use of the property during their stay.

This vacation home is located in Glasgow. Barshaw Golf Club and Whitecraigs Golf Club are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Dams to Darnley Country Park and Gleniffer Braes Country Park. Looking to enjoy an event or a game while in town? See what's happening at OVO Hydro or Braehead Arena.
